dar*_*mos 8 language-agnostic simulation low-memory cpu-speed
我想以这种方式对我的应用程序进行压力测试,因为它似乎在一些非常老的客户机中失败了.
起初我读了一些关于QEmu的内容并考虑了硬件仿真,但这似乎是一个很长的镜头.我在超级用户那里问过,但是还没有收到太多反馈.
所以我转向你们......你们这样的测试怎么样?
我不确定是否会降低CPU速度,但如果使用虚拟机(如VMWare),则可以控制实际使用的RAM数量.我在家里的MBP上以8GB运行它,我的WinXP VM的上限为1.5 GB RAM.
编辑:我刚检查了我的VMWare版本,我可以控制它可以使用的核心数量.它绝对不是一个较慢的CPU,但它可能会突出一些问题.
由于旧硬件或旧操作系统导致您的应用程序失败并不完全清楚,因此VM客户端应该允许您相当快速地测试各种版本的操作系统.几年前,当我试图让一个.Net 2.0应用程序在Win98上运行时,它对我来说很方便(虽然我不记得我是如何工作的,但它可以完成......).